Legal Status for Canadian Bettors
Single-game sports betting became legal across Canada in August 2021 when Bill C-218 passed. Each province now regulates its own market. Ontario launched its competitive iGaming framework in April 2022, licensing private operators alongside OLG's PROLINE+. British Columbia, Alberta, and Quebec run provincial platforms but also allow offshore sites that accept Canadians. Where you bet on the Stanley Cup depends partly on your province—Ontario residents have 40+ licensed options, while bettors in other provinces often use internationally regulated sites operating in grey-market territory.

Odds Formats and Market Variety
Canadian bookmakers display odds in American (-150/+130), decimal (1.67/2.30), or fractional (2/3, 13/10) formats. Most sites default to American for NHL, though you can switch in account settings. Decimal odds work better for calculating exact payouts—multiply your stake by the number shown. Stanley Cup odds update every few seconds during games, so live bettors benefit from platforms with faster refresh rates and lower latency on mobile apps.
Stanley Cup Playoffs Markets Worth Exploring
Game moneylines get the most action, but these sites offer far more creative options. Spreading bets across market types can reduce variance while keeping playoff nights exciting.
- Series correct score: Predict the exact series outcome (4-0, 4-1, 4-2, 4-3). These pay 3:1 to 12:1 depending on matchup competitiveness. Sweeps against heavy underdogs often hide value.
- Conference/Division winners: Lock in picks before Round 1 for better odds than betting series-by-series. Western Conference futures typically carry higher juice due to parity.
- Player points totals: Season-long playoff props on stars like McDavid or MacKinnon. Lines usually open around 25-30 points for elite producers.
- Team to score first: A simple proposition that removes final outcome stress. Home teams hit this at 54% historically in playoff games.
- Overtime yes/no: Stanley Cup games go to OT roughly 23% of the time—higher than regular season. "Yes" often prices around +300.
- Conn Smythe Trophy: MVP betting opens when playoffs begin. Goalies and top-line centers dominate, but defensemen offer longer odds with solid ROI historically.
Combining these markets through same-game parlays can multiply returns, though correlation rules vary by sportsbook. Check each site's SGP restrictions before building complex tickets. Risks and Limits to Watch
Stanley Cup betting carries real financial risk. Playoff hockey's unpredictability—hot goalies, injuries, referee variance—makes even strong analysis fallible. Know these factors before wagering significant amounts:
- Betting limits: Sportsbooks cap maximum wagers, especially on props and futures. Limits tighten during playoffs. We found $500-$2,000 caps on player props at most sites, with higher allowances on game moneylines ($5,000-$25,000).
- Odds manipulation: Sharp money moves lines quickly. By the time casual bettors see "value," professionals have often already corrected it. Lines move 10-15 cents within hours of opening.
- Bonus wagering requirements: Welcome offers sound generous, but 8x-15x rollover requirements mean a $50 bonus needs $400-$750 in bets before withdrawal. Read terms carefully.
- Account restrictions: Consistent winners face stake limits or account closures. This happens more frequently on props and obscure markets where edges are easier to find.
- Emotional betting: Playoff intensity increases temptation to chase losses or overbet on "lock" games. Neither strategy works long-term.

Responsible Gambling Tools
Every licensed Canadian betting site offers built-in controls. Deposit limits let you cap daily, weekly, or monthly funding—changes take 24-72 hours to prevent impulsive increases. Loss limits trigger automatic session ends when you hit predetermined thresholds. Self-exclusion ranges from 24 hours to permanent bans. Ontario's iGaming sites connect to a provincial self-exclusion database, blocking you from all licensed operators simultaneously. Use these tools proactively, not as last resorts.
